CORPORATIONS REGULATIONS 2001 - REG 5.6.31A

Person may attend and vote by attorney

         (1)    A person entitled to attend and vote at a meeting may attend and vote at a meeting by his or her attorney.

         (2)    A person claiming to be the attorney of a person entitled to attend and vote at a meeting is not entitled to speak or vote as attorney at the meeting (except in relation to the election of a chairperson) unless:

                (a)    the instrument by which the person was appointed as attorney has been produced to the chairperson; or

               (b)    the chairperson is otherwise satisfied that the person claiming to be the attorney of the person entitled to vote is the duly authorised attorney of that person.
